How are tattoos removed?

Beautologie uses the Q-switched Nd Yag laser, which utilizes an intense beam of light that helps to dramatically lighten or completely remove your tattoo. The concentrated light breaks down the ink into tiny particles, which are safely absorbed through your skin with your body’s natural, cleaning mechanism. After your session, the treated area can scab up and when the scab comes off, some of the tattoo leaves with it.

How many laser tattoo treatments are required?

As each tattoo is different, so is the number of treatments required to remove it. Things like size, location, depth and especially color of your tattoo all contribute to how quickly it can be lightened or removed. Your tattoo removal sessions are scheduled 6-8 weeks apart to allow your skin to heal between treatments. Patients will generally start to notice the lightening of their tattoo soon after the very first session, however 5-15 treatments may be needed for optimal results. FAQ

What is laser tattoo removal?

Laser tattoo removal is a cosmetic procedure that uses laser energy to break up the ink particles in a tattoo. The laser targets the ink, causing it to fragment into smaller pieces that are then naturally removed by the body's immune system.

Is laser tattoo removal safe for men?

Yes, laser tattoo removal is generally safe for men when performed by a qualified and experienced healthcare professional.

How long does laser tattoo removal take?

The duration of laser tattoo removal treatment varies depending on the size, location, and complexity of the tattoo. Small tattoos may only take a few minutes, while larger and more complex tattoos may require multiple sessions over several months.

How many laser tattoo removal sessions are needed?

The number of laser tattoo removal sessions needed varies depending on the individual and the tattoo being treated. Generally, most patients require between six and ten treatments to achieve optimal results.

Is laser tattoo removal painful?

Laser tattoo removal can be uncomfortable, but most patients report that the discomfort is tolerable. Some individuals may experience mild stinging or burning sensations during the treatment.

What is the recovery time after laser tattoo removal?

There is generally no downtime or recovery period required after laser tattoo removal. However, patients may experience temporary redness, swelling, and blistering at the treatment site.

Are there any potential side effects of laser tattoo removal?

Some potential side effects of laser tattoo removal include temporary redness, swelling, blistering, and scabbing at the treatment site. In rare cases, more serious side effects such as scarring or changes in skin color may occur.

How long do the effects of laser tattoo removal last?

The effects of laser tattoo removal are generally long-lasting, with many patients experiencing significant fading or complete removal of their tattoo. However, some ink colors and types may be more difficult to remove, and new tattoos may be more resistant to laser treatment.

Can laser tattoo removal be combined with other treatments?

Laser tattoo removal can be combined with other cosmetic treatments, such as skin resurfacing or chemical peels, to achieve a more comprehensive approach to tattoo removal. However, it is important to discuss these options with your healthcare provider to determine the best course of treatment for your individual needs.

Is laser tattoo removal covered by insurance?

Laser tattoo removal is typically considered a cosmetic procedure and is not covered by insurance. However, some healthcare providers may offer financing or payment plans to make the procedure more affordable.
